Scratching Vinyl (2);

Apr. 13th, 2012 | 07:54 pm

Friday was a long day.

After a school day of being singled out by sitting in the front and copying from Confetti's messy paper, Melody kneeled on the family couch,trying hard not to strain at her surrounds lest she hurt her eyes. She heard Treble alternate between tapping on a drum and banging on a piano.

She listened closely.."If you're trying to play 'Fillyharmony's Lullabye', you're playing an A where a B Flat should go."

He groaned. "No one asked you!" he said, before going back to the off tune.

Moments later,"...Um, what's the flat note again?" 

The unicorn did a quick internal count. "Five notes in -"

The door opened with the tinkle of a bell. Treble and Melody's father, Short Sighted, came in "Mel! I've bought something for you, come here!"

Due to his fault in the accident, Choira had appointed Treble as Melody's seeing-eye assistant. He plodded into the room, tugged his sister's tail, and together they walked into the kitchen. Short Sighted was a gray-flanked colt with short white hair and large cokebottle glasses. "Had a good day, dear?" He asked.

"Not quite," Melody replied. They spotted a large pearly gray box on the table - in her case, a smudge. "What's in that?" Asked Treble, trying hard to lift it with magic.

Sighted unlatched it and lifted the cover.

Purple, oval-shaped glass was surrounded by thick black frames. Melody stared at them. "Do you like them?"

"Er..."

"Put 'em on!" cried Treble, resuming his struggle.

"They did look better on the mannequin." Shrugged Sighted. "Give them a try."

Slowly, she lifted them to her face. Instantly, the kitchen came into sharp focus. Surprisingly, nothing was in a purple tint. When she voiced this, her father beamed "We did it in the lab for you. What do you think?"

"They match your mane an' tail!"

They did very well match her mane and tail of alternating electric and navy blue. Although slightly big, it was just such a joy to have her vision fully restored and saw that, yes, these glasses did look far better on her face - and leaps and bounds better than her old granny glasses.

"They're smashtastic! I love them, thank you!" She pulled her brother along by the tail, shouting "Let's go play that piece right! If the great Strings Concordia could hear you, why, the mare would weep!"

Scratching Vinyl;

Apr. 13th, 2012 | 04:47 pm



Treble had taken her glasses and ran to the attic. 

Melody could hardly see with them, but without them? In the dark? That rendered her visibility to nearly nothing nothing but blurs.  She held her head out, horn forward, to warn of potential obstacles, for her magic was weak from plinking on a keyboard all day.

After slowly making her way up the steps, she saw a black smudge between two cheerful yellow walls - the attic door was ajar.

She poked her head through, and was rewarded with shrieking laughter "Haha, it's a game, Melly!"

Melody growled and stomped a hoof. "What do I gotta do? It better take a while, because I'll kill you when we're through!"

"Stop using your horn's glow." Not like it helped. She complied, and took a few steps forward.


"Trebs! Hand 'em over, this isn't funny!"

There was muffled giggling, then "Two steps forward. Then -"

crunch.

"Maybe just one step."

Snout nearly to the ground, Looking closely, Melody could see her glasses, small half-circles that looked like something an elder pony would wear, the sides twisted awkwardly. Smashed in the middle.

"Treble!" Throwing caution away, she charged forward, knocking down unpacked boxes, furious, not stopping until her brother said 
something - A shriek of fright as he fell from his hiding place.

When their mother returned from the market, Melody had dragged Treble by the tail and held him down in the kitchen and awaited her.

"What is this? Melody, where are your glasses?"

"In the attic. In a pile of shards!"

Choira sighed, and told Treble to put away the groceries, that their father would come home to deal with him. "Sit here, Melody," She said, directing her to the living room. "We'll find something to do."
